What's an Apify Actor?

Actors are web data automations that power AI and operations. They run on the Apify platform to scrape websites, process data, connect APIs, and automate workflows. In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ours, and optionally produces a well-defined JSON output, datasets with results, or files in key-value store. In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server. Actors are written with capital "A".

SEO & Web Analysis MCP

A Model Context Protocol server that gives AI agents SEO and site-analysis tools — on-page crawl, tech-stack detection, DNS, SSL and WHOIS — as callable tools. For SEO, audit and recon agents.

🛠 Tools (5)

  • check_dns — DNS records for a domain.
  • check_ssl — SSL/TLS certificate details.
  • crawl_website — Crawl a site for on-page SEO data.
  • detect_tech_stack — Detect a site's technology stack.
  • lookup_whois — WHOIS registration data for a domain.

MCP server setup

{
    "mcpServers": {
        "apify": {
            "type": "http",
            "url": "https://mcp.apify.com/?tools=fetch-actor-details,nexgendata/seo-web-analysis-mcp-server"
        }
    }
}

The hosted server signs you in with OAuth on first connect, so no API token belongs in this config. Clients without OAuth support can send an Authorization: Bearer <APIFY_API_TOKEN> header instead, using a token from API & Integrations in Apify Console (https://console.apify.com/settings/integrations).
